Live: Enjoy the view of Wuzhi Mountain, the highest mountain in Hainan Province

Wuzhi Mountain, also referred to as Five Finger Mountain, is the tallest peak in Hainan Province, soaring 1,840 meters above the heart of the island. The mountain's peaks form a jagged, saw-tooth pattern, resembling the shape of five fingers, which is how Wuzhi Mountain got its name.
